Concor Infrastructure invites suitably qualified candidates to apply for the position of Workshop Material Controller at the Msikaba Bridge Manufacturing – Highveld Workshop in Emalahleni.The successful candidate will be responsible for controlling the receipt, verification, identification, storage, issuing, movement, and traceability of materials throughout the manufacturing process.This role supports uninterrupted fabrication by ensuring material availability, accurate records, production readiness, and compliance with approved drawings, specifications, project procedures, quality requirements, and HSE standards.In line with our Employment Equity commitments, preference may be given to suitably qualified candidates from designated groups.

The successful candidate will be accountable for, but not limited to, the following key outputs :

Material Control and Handling

  • Receive, inspect, verify, identify, store, preserve, and issue materials in line with project procedures, approved specifications, work packs, nesting schedules, and fabrication priorities.
  • Check certificates, heat numbers, grades, dimensions, quantities, purchase orders, and delivery documents to ensure material compliance and traceability.
  • Coordinate safe material handling and movement within the workshop to prevent damage, deterioration, loss, or loss of traceability.
  • Maintain accurate material registers, issue records, stock balances, traceability records, and inventory documentation.
  • Monitor material availability, report shortages or discrepancies, and assist with stock counts, reconciliations, and audits.

Production Support and Nesting

  • Confirm material availability, allocate correct grades and plate sizes, and ensure materials are ready for planned fabrication activities.
  • Coordinate with Planning and Production to optimise material use, reduce waste, and support manufacturing schedules.
  • Control offcuts and reusable materials by ensuring correct identification, recording, and return to stock where applicable.

Material Verification and Traceability

  • Verify that materials issued for fabrication comply with approved drawings, specifications, client requirements, and quality procedures.
  • Maintain traceability from receipt through cutting, fabrication, assembly, and final completion.
  • Support QA/QC during inspections, audits, client witness activities, MRBs, Quality Data Books, and handover documentation.
  • Identify and report discrepancies, damaged materials, incorrect certifications, or non-conforming products, and support corrective actions.

Health, Safety and Environmental Compliance

  • Perform material handling and control activities in accordance with project HSE requirements, company policies, and applicable legislation.
  • Promote safe work practices during workshop activities, including lifting operations, material handling, access, hot work interfaces, and related hazards.
  • Report unsafe conditions, participate in toolbox talks and risk assessments, and support corrective actions arising from audits, inspections, or incidents.
  • Support the organisation’s commitment to Zero Harm, continuous safety improvement, and compliance with statutory, client, and project HSE requirements.
